
Functional Programming on the JVM with Daniel from RockTheJVM
The GeekNarrator
00:00
Introduction to Functional Programming on the JVM
This chapter discusses the shift in mindset required when approaching functional programming on the JVM. The speaker explains the difference between instructional thinking and expression-oriented thinking, and highlights the importance of thinking of code in terms of expressions. They also compare functional programming with imperative programming and object-oriented programming, emphasizing that they are not opposites but can coexist.
Transcript
Play full episode